two.1.4) Short description

Negotiated without a prior call for competition

The works, supplies or services can be provided only by a particular economic operator for the following reason:

protection of exclusive rights, including intellectual property rights

Explanation:

AQL is our primary datacentre, it would be significant business risk to rush into a plan to relocate the primary datacentre and network communication links. We decided to continue our existing relationship with AQL for the stability of datacentre services due to the current financial position of the university group and the pressures facing the education sector. Technology is also changing at a rapid pace which makes it difficult to accurately predict long term placement of services as we continue to adopt more cloud technology. The AQL service is to remain in place for the next 2 years while a formal review is undertaken of our datacentre requirements. Once this decision is made, the university will go through a formal tender process for these services for a longer term partnership agreement.
